BANGS Shoes - Hannah Davis

On the latest episode we speak to Hannah Davis who founded BANGS Shoes in an effort to satisfy her appetite for philanthropy. BANGS Shoes are modeled after simple work boots Hannah discovered when she was teaching English in China. The company makes shoes that are made from 100% vegan, ethically sourced materials inside a factory whose workers are treated with dignity and respect. The company has partnered with KIVA.org in an effort to grow the entrepreneurship community around the world. The motto is simple: Buy BANGS Shoes = Your Adventures Help Others Find Theirs. Blueland (as seen on Shark Tank) - Sarah Paiji-Yoo

We interview Sarah Paiji-Yoo, Founder of Blueland, and hear how she launched Blueland. The company is focused on cleaning up our planet by cleaning our homes. Starting with cleaning products - items traditionally sold in disposable plastic bottles, Blueland can eliminate over 100 billion single-use plastic bottles in the US alone because their cleaners live in 100% reusable bottles. Sarah details how she first came up with the idea and shares her entire Shark Tank experience and how it's impacted her company. Take a listen!

Kindred Bravely - Deeanne and Garret Akerson

Pre COVID19 we had a great chat with the Founders of Kindred Bravely. In a hopeful return to normalcy we wanted to share their amazing story. It all began when Deeanne, co-founder/CEO, was nursing her one-year-old and couldn't find a comfortable and cute pair of pajamas. She decided to design her own – a simple idea that became something extraordinary. The company has 2 goals: creating maternity and nursing clothes that are beautiful, useful, and comfortable, and building a community of moms who support and encourage each other on the motherhood journey.
